
在连接数据库之后,我们可以使用DB Query()函数执行SQL查询语句,并将查询结果保存到*sql Rows类型的对象中
腾讯云 2023-04-27 10:34:48
(资料图片仅供参考)
在连接数据库之后,我们可以使用DB.Query()
函数执行SQL查询语句,并将查询结果保存到*sql.Rows
类型的对象中。以下是一个使用DB.Query()
函数查询一张表中的所有数据的示例:
goCopy coderows, err := db.Query("SELECT * FROM users")if err != nil { panic(err)}defer rows.Close()for rows.Next() { var id int var name string var age int err = rows.Scan(&id, &name, &age) if err != nil { panic(err) } fmt.Println(id, name, age)}err = rows.Err()if err != nil { panic(err)}
在上述代码中,我们调用db.Query()
函数执行一个SELECT语句,并将结果保存到*sql.Rows
类型的对象中。我们通过迭代*sql.Rows
对象中的每一行数据来处理查询结果。在迭代每一行数据时,我们调用rows.Scan()`方法将每一行数据保存到变量中,并打印出来。
最后,我们还需要检查查询过程中是否出现了错误。如果出现了错误,我们将通过rows.Err()
方法获取到错误信息,并进行相应的处理。
在连接数据库之后,我们可以使用DB Query()函数执行SQL查询语句,并将查询结果保存到*sql Rows类型的对象中
五一是传统的旅游和消费旺季,所以今天我也来做一下五一的手机推荐购买策略。今天主要是说下2k价位小米品牌
以下是国瓷材料在北京时间4月27日09:58分盘口异动快照:4月27日,国瓷材料盘中快速上涨,5分钟内涨幅超过2%
脂肪肉瘤是肉瘤中较常见的一种。多见于40岁以上的成年人,但也可能发生在儿童中。常发生在大腿及腹膜后等深
安徽省黟县碧山村由古祠堂改造而成的碧山书局,是村里最聚人气的公共文化场所之一;河南省修武县大南坡村的
国盛证券刘高畅在节目中表示,ChatGPT不再是0—1,和应用端结合起来之后已经进入1—N的阶段,使得资本市场
未来,加快推进区域营商环境一体化,亟需厘清并解决好一些深层次问题,建立规则统一的制度体系,消除阻碍生
Shams:福克斯将会出战今天对阵勇士的天王山之战,勇士,维金斯,美国篮球,天王山之战,德阿隆·福克斯
世界读书日当天,山东省临沂市市民在书店选购图书。许传宝摄(人民图片)4月21日,学生在江苏省苏州市昆山
1、现在国内的鱼油都比这些好干嘛还买国外的,至少从纯度这一方面国内的一些鱼油品牌在纯度方面就领先国际
4月26日《崩坏:星穹铁道》公测上线,四月限行。未上线就登顶全球100+地区,开服5小时空降境内AppStore总榜
1、赋;音:fù 1 旧指田地税:田~。2、~税。3、2 中国古典文学的一种文体。4、3 念诗或作诗:登高~诗。5
1、天天艺术出版社有一本绿色的独奏教材其上貌似有望春风将一的萨克斯谱,自己翻不会吗,如果有伴奏带,就
4月份,国内MMA市场快速拉涨,MMA月均价格上涨,截至26日,华东、山东、华南市场月均价分别为11336元 吨、1
大象新闻